Bay High School Rockets Narrowly Fall to Lakewood in Valentine's Day Basketball Clash

Cale LaRiccia | Bay High School | Feb 15, 2025

In a spirited varsity basketball clash on Valentine's Day, the Bay High School Rockets faced a tough defeat, falling 55-66 against the Lakewood Rangers. The face-off took place on home turf, maintaining a charged atmosphere throughout the evening.

The game kicked off intensely with both teams neck and neck, leading to a halftime deadlock at 23 points each. Key performances came from Ryan Miller and Collin Melvin of Bay High, who scored 18 and 17 points respectively. Despite their efforts, the Rockets couldn't maintain their momentum against the Rangers' advances in the second half.

Held on February 14, 2025, the game marks a continuation of the season for the Rockets, who now hold a record of 11-11, with a 6-8 standing in the Cleveland West Conference. Looking ahead, the Rockets are set to regroup and face Benedictine in their next regular season game scheduled for February 21, 2025, once again on their home court at Bay High School.
